View Full Version : مشکل در گزارش گیری با Quick Report
hghodsi
یک شنبه 27 دی 1383, 11:23 صبح
با سلام بر دوستان
می خواهم گزارشی تهیه بکنم از دروس پاس شده توسط یک یا چند کارمند. یعنی در یک گزارش مشخص کنم که چه کارمندی چه درسی یا پاس کرده است یا یک درس توسط چه کارمندانی پاس شده است . و چون داده ها در چند جدول قرار دارد مجبورم از Query استفاده بکنم. در Quick Report برای این کار MasterField جدول دروس پاس شده را شماره کارمندی جدول کارمندان (Ado_personal) در نظر گرفتم .
هنگامی در محیط دلفی بر روی Quick Report خود دکمه سمت راست را زده و Preview را انتخاب می کنم اطلاعات درست نمایش داده می شود
ولی در هنگام اجرای برنامه اطلاعات بدرستی نمایش داده نمی شود.
طفا از کسانی که اطلاعاتی در این زمینه دارند مرا راهنمایی بکنند. و یا اینکه توضیح بدهند بهترین روش برای تهیه گزارش بالا چیست و از چه نرم افزاری باید استفاده بنکم ؟؟
یک شنبه 27 دی 1383, 11:58 صبح
یکی از دلایل حذف quickreport در دلفی 7 باگهای اون بود مخصوصا در موقع چاپ گزارش البته من نمیگم صددرصد این باگ quickreport باشه .
میتونی از گزارش ساز rave یا fastreport استفاده کنی که البته من fastreport خودم استفاده میکنم و نحوه تهیه اون هم سرورمون آقای کرامتی گزینه خوبی هستند .
hghodsi
یک شنبه 27 دی 1383, 12:03 عصر
من fastreport خودم استفاده میکنم و نحوه تهیه اون هم سرورمون آقای کرامتی گزینه خوبی هستند .
با تشکر
از کجا می تونم fastreport را تهیه کنم؟ و طرز کار آن به چه صورتیه ؟
hr110
یک شنبه 27 دی 1383, 12:59 عصر
یکی از دلایل حذف quickreport در دلفی 7
از کدوم حذف صحبت میکنید؟
از کجا می تونم fastreport را تهیه کنم؟ و طرز کار آن به چه صورتیه ؟
هم در سی دی های برنامه نویس وجود داره هم در اینترنت،
ضمناً این حقیر reportbuilder را به هر چیز دیگری ترجیح میدم
مهندس
یک شنبه 27 دی 1383, 14:08 عصر
یکی از دلایل حذف quickreport در دلفی 7 باگهای اون بود مخصوصا در موقع چاپ گزارش البته من نمیگم صددرصد این باگ quickreport باشه .
سلام
:kaf:
Quick Report 3 در دلفی 7 موجود میباشد :موفق:
The Quick Reports package is not installed in the IDE by default. To run
these demos you must first install dclqrt70.bpl.
To install, go to the IDE menu and select the "Component" menu item. From there,
select "Install Packages". In the dialog select the "Add" button and then browse
to the \bin directory of Delphi (default location is
c:\Program Files\Borland\Delphi7\bin). Select the file named dclqrt70.bpl.
The QuickReport pacakge is now installed and you can run the example programs.
همینطور که نوشته شده باید پکیج dclqrt70.bpl نصب بشه :موفق:
پنج شنبه 01 بهمن 1383, 13:43 عصر
3 در دلفی 7 موجود میباشد
The Quick Reports package is not installed in the IDE by default. To run
these demos you must first install dclqrt70.bpl.
To install, go to the IDE menu and select the "Component" menu item. From there,
select "Install Packages". In the dialog select the "Add" button and then browse
to the \bin directory of Delphi (default location is
c:\Program Files\Borland\Delphi7\bin). Select the file named dclqrt70.bpl.
The QuickReport pacakge is now installed and you can run the example programs.
همینطور که نوشته شده باید پکیج dclqrt70.bpl نصب بشه
سلام آقای hr110 میدونم پکیج اون هست ولی دلیل نصب نبودنش واقعا باگهای اون است من هم خودم هم بعضی از بروبچ شرکت یا دانشگاه به این مشکل بر خوردیم و همین طور کنترلهای serversocket و clientsocket نیز از دلفی 7 حذف شدند ولی پکیجشون در پوشه bin هستش
hr110
جمعه 02 بهمن 1383, 07:45 صبح
واقعا باگهای اون است
اگر ممکن است چند نمونه از این باگها را بفرمایید، چرا که حداقل در چند پروژه کوچک و بزرگ هیچ مشکلی نداشته ام :)
Dolphin
جمعه 02 بهمن 1383, 11:41 صبح
سلام دوست عزیز
این مشکل یک باگ quickreport نیست بلکه شما link های جداول را درست انتخاب نکرده اید من هم با این مشکل خیلی برخورد کردم بهترین کاریی که بهتون پیشنهاد می کنم اینکه از مثالهای quickreport درون شاخه دلفی استفاده کنی خیلی کمکت می کنه راستی برای اینکه درون برنام بتونی درست استفاده کنی باید حتما جداول را قبلا نسبت داده باشی به هر باند و سپس درون کد برنامه اونا را باز کنی که باید یه تیکه کد خودت بنویسی کار بسیار راحتی به مثالها سری بزن .
:sunglass:
esi022
یک شنبه 04 بهمن 1383, 04:32 صبح
quickreport خیلی هم توپه
نکته مهم اینه که باهاش ور رفته باشی و نکاتی که دوستمون Dolphin گفت رو رعایت کنی چون مهمه که باند گزاری کنی.
query که نوشتی صحیحه؟
MehdiRah
یک شنبه 04 بهمن 1383, 09:19 صبح
سلام
یکی از اشکالات که به quick report میشه گرفت نداشتن custom page است یعنی نمیتوان از برنامه page setup رو عوض کرد و باید اینکارو روی خود یرینتر انجام بدی
ا :cry:
hr110
یک شنبه 04 بهمن 1383, 20:52 عصر
سلام
یکی از اشکالات که به quick report میشه گرفت نداشتن custom page است یعنی نمیتوان از برنامه page setup رو عوض کرد و باید اینکارو روی خود یرینتر انجام بدی
ا :cry:
دوست عزیز شما هر مشخصه ایی از صفحه را بخواهید میتوانید به سادگی عوض کنید،
mehdi_moosavi
سه شنبه 06 بهمن 1383, 01:26 صبح
سلام
منم یه مشکل با quick report داشتم بالاخره هم رفع نشد.
میخواستم صفحات زوج یا فرد رو چاپ بگیره.
البته با fast report انجام شد
vBulletin® v4.2.5, Copyright ©2000-1404, Jelsoft Enterprises Ltd.